su root 使用root
ls
ls -l
cd
pwd --当前目录
mkdir 目录名 --建立目录
rmdir 目录名 --移除目录
rm -r 目录名 --移除目录和子目录(每个文件夹都询问一次)
rm -rf 目录名 --一次删除所有目录和子目录
touch 文件名 --创建空文件
cp 文件名 新文件名 --复制文件
mv 文件名 目录名 --移动文件
vi/vim 文件名 --编辑文件
:wq 存盘退出
:q! 不存盘退出
vim 文件名 --查看文件
more 文件名 --显示内容
cat 文件名 --正序显示内容
tac 文件名 --反序显示内容
head -n 文件名 --显示几行的内容,n为第N行
find 路径 -name 文件名 --查询文件 如 find /dev -name cdro*
whereis 命令名 --查询命令路径 例如 where ls
echo $PATH 查询环境变量 windows下用 echo%path%
ln 文件名 新文件名: 作用和拷贝相似,但是源文件修改,新文件也会被修改
ln -s 文件名 新文件名: 相当于windows下的快捷方式
useradd 用户名 --添加用户 可以在/home中查看
passwd 用户名 --设置密码
more passwd --查看用户 在/etc
groupadd 组名 --添加组
useradd 用户名 -g 组名 --将user加入到指定组
more group --查看组 在/etc目录
usermod -g 用户名 组名
chmod +x 文件名 添加权限
chmod -x 文件名 去掉权限
chmod u+x 文件名 当前用户添加权限
chmod 775 文件名 二进制 111101101 所以代表对应位置的权限
chmod 777 文件名 所有权限都有 二进制
chown 用户名 4 改变文件属于哪个用户
grep 文件名 在指定文件中查找指定的字符串
管道:
ls -Rl 文件名 | more 分页显示内容
wall msg 通知所有人
wall < a.txt 将a.txt的内容通知给所有人
ls > cmd.txt 将内容输出到cmd.txt
ls >> cmd.txt 将内容输出到cmd.txt 复制两次
lsss 2> cmd.txt 错误重定向信息输出到cmd.txt
41、Linux初步(学习到的linux命令)
最新推荐文章于 2023-05-16 11:27:52 发布